
News Wrap: N.Y., Calif. to adopt nation's top minimum wage
Clip: 4/4/2016 | 4m 10s
Governors in New York and California signed bills that raise their minimum wage.
In our news wrap Monday, governors in New York and California signed bills that raise their minimum wage to the highest in the nation over time. Also, the Supreme Court unanimously upheld a Texas law that counts overall population, not just eligible voters, in drawing districts.
